What problem does it solve?

Migration of journal structures and templates can introduce data integrity risks and rollback challenges. This skill provides a controlled, auditable workflow with bootstrap, worktree isolation, and staged validation to minimize data loss and ensure repeatable migrations.

Core Features & Use Cases

  • Structured migration pipelines: descriptor-driven migrations with explicit mappings, validation, and optional cleanup.
  • Environment isolation: worktree setup and start to run migrations without affecting main portals.
  • Guided workflow: steps to inspect portal state, scaffold descriptors, validate changes, and execute migrations safely.
  • Use Case: When a journal structure or template evolves, apply this skill to migrate content and templates with rollback-capable steps.
